Output 652a9952a380521029e38bbd0f73dfe930e849b208486aa0c3cb89fc352946b6:1

value
194390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90a4b281c1bf1ff9eba564ee615bcd8dcdefd322 OP_EQUAL
address
3EspXY2nA4fckUc7kyJ3cwRe4zK6tDmuyP
transaction
652a9952a380521029e38bbd0f73dfe930e849b208486aa0c3cb89fc352946b6
confirmations
282696
spent
true